Twisted Thicketway Puzzle Guide In Crimson Desert

Twisted Thicketway puzzle guide in Crimson Desert Image via Game Rant; Source: Pearl Abyss

You get the Twisted Thicketway Abyss challenge after completing the Ancient Sealed Gate puzzle in Crimson Desert.

Twisted Thicketway 1 n Crimson Desert Image via Game Rant; Source: Pearl Abyss

Stand on the fan at the top of Sage’s Peak and activate it. Then, open your wings above it. That will take you to the Twisted Thicketway floating island in the Abyss.

Twisted Thicketway 2 n Crimson Desert Image via Game Rant; Source: Pearl Abyss

There, stand on an Abyss Nexus to open a fast travel Waypoint in Crimson Desert.

Twisted Thicketway 3 n Crimson Desert Image via Game Rant; Source: Pearl Abyss

Step forward, and a boss fight against an Abyss Kutum will start.

Twisted Thicketway 4 n Crimson Desert Image via Game Rant; Source: Pearl Abyss

There are multiple ways to beat the Abyss Kutum in Crimson Desert. The best way to defeat it is by using your Axiom Force on its glowing red eye at the top of its body. Then, you can pull the eye out of its body to complete its stun meter. This will give you enough time to deal massive damage to the Abyss Kutum while it’s down.

Twisted Thicketway 5 n Crimson Desert Image via Game Rant; Source: Pearl Abyss

Note that the Abyss Kutum doesn’t take damage from normal melee attacks, where you can keep swinging your sword, but nothing reaches it. However, if you build Kliff with Abyss Gears that shoot elemental attacks out of his swords, that can severely damage the Abyss Kutum and eventually fill its stun meter.

Twisted Thicketway 6 n Crimson Desert Image via Game Rant; Source: Pearl Abyss

It’s always good to stun the Abyss Kutum​​​​​, as that will give you time to deal heavy damage. Additionally, Kutum’s attacks are slow and predictable, so you won’t need that much healing when fighting it in the Twisted Thicketway.

Twisted Thicketway 7 n Crimson Desert Image via Game Rant; Source: Pearl Abyss

After defeating the Abyss Kutum, you can restore the Abyss by climbing the structure in the boss fight arena.

Twisted Thicketway 8 n Crimson Desert Image via Game Rant; Source: Pearl Abyss

Make sure to force palm the Abyss button, advance to claim the Abyss Artifact, and that will solve the Twisted Thicketway puzzle in Crimson Desert.
